mergerfs:add_a_new_data_disk
Differences
This shows you the differences between two versions of the page.
mergerfs:add_a_new_data_disk [2025/05/12 21:07] – created peter | mergerfs:add_a_new_data_disk [2025/05/12 21:58] (current) – peter |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== MergerFS - Add a new data disk ====== | ====== MergerFS - Add a new data disk ====== | ||
- | From within | + | ===== View the current setup ===== |
+ | |||
+ | Install | ||
<code bash> | <code bash> | ||
- | xattr -w user.mergerfs.srcmounts | + | apt install python-xattr |
+ | </ | ||
+ | |||
+ | |||
+ | Assuming the root of the mergerfs filesystem is /storage, use xattrs to view the pseudo .mergerfs file: | ||
+ | |||
+ | <code bash> | ||
+ | cd /storage | ||
+ | xattr -l .mergerfs | ||
+ | </ | ||
+ | |||
+ | returns: | ||
+ | |||
+ | < | ||
+ | user.mergerfs.srcmounts: /mnt/data/disk01:/mnt/ | ||
+ | user.mergerfs.minfreespace: | ||
+ | user.mergerfs.moveonenospc: | ||
+ | user.mergerfs.policies: | ||
+ | user.mergerfs.version: | ||
+ | user.mergerfs.pid: | ||
+ | user.mergerfs.category.action: | ||
+ | user.mergerfs.category.create: | ||
+ | user.mergerfs.category.search: | ||
+ | user.mergerfs.func.access: | ||
+ | user.mergerfs.func.chmod: | ||
+ | user.mergerfs.func.chown: | ||
+ | user.mergerfs.func.create: | ||
+ | user.mergerfs.func.getattr: | ||
+ | user.mergerfs.func.getxattr: | ||
+ | user.mergerfs.func.link: | ||
+ | user.mergerfs.func.listxattr: | ||
+ | user.mergerfs.func.mkdir: | ||
+ | user.mergerfs.func.mknod: | ||
+ | user.mergerfs.func.open: | ||
+ | user.mergerfs.func.readlink: | ||
+ | user.mergerfs.func.removexattr: | ||
+ | user.mergerfs.func.rename: | ||
+ | user.mergerfs.func.rmdir: | ||
+ | user.mergerfs.func.setxattr: | ||
+ | user.mergerfs.func.symlink: | ||
+ | user.mergerfs.func.truncate: | ||
+ | user.mergerfs.func.unlink: | ||
+ | user.mergerfs.func.utimens: | ||
</ | </ | ||
<WRAP info> | <WRAP info> | ||
- | **NOTE: | + | **NOTE: |
- | Use the following command to install it: | + | * / |
+ | * / | ||
+ | * / | ||
+ | |||
+ | |||
+ | All of options shown can be set in real time without unmounting and re-mounting | ||
+ | |||
+ | </ | ||
+ | |||
+ | ---- | ||
+ | |||
+ | ===== Add a disk ===== | ||
+ | |||
+ | From within the root of the mergerfs filesystem (eg. /storage) | ||
<code bash> | <code bash> | ||
- | apt install python-xattr | + | xattr -w user.mergerfs.srcmounts ' |
+ | |||
+ | or, for adding two disks use: | ||
+ | |||
+ | xattr -w user.mergerfs.srcmounts ' | ||
</ | </ | ||
+ | <WRAP info> | ||
+ | **NOTE: | ||
</ | </ | ||
mergerfs/add_a_new_data_disk.1747084051.txt.gz · Last modified: 2025/05/12 21:07 by peter